In medical abbreviations, what does "wt" signify?

Explanation:
The abbreviation "wt" signifies "weight." In medical contexts, this abbreviation is commonly used in various documentation and communication regarding a patient's measurements and health assessments. Weight is an important vital sign that helps healthcare providers evaluate a patient's overall health, nutritional status, and any potential need for interventions related to medication dosing, dietary changes, or physical activity recommendations. While other abbreviations might relate to health and anatomy, such as "width," "wrist," and "wound treatment," these do not accurately reflect the meaning of "wt." Each of those terms serves different purposes in healthcare settings, yet "weight" is specifically denoted by the abbreviation "wt," making it the correct and recognized usage in medical terminology.
